The Gamers' Choice Awards - held by CBS for the first time ever - was also dominated by Fortnite in the same fashion as the Golden Joysticks, but at least it was outright noted that the choice was actually made by fans. It's literally mentioned in the nominations. Let's take a look at the categories that list Fortnite as the winner - including the best game. Oh yeah, that's right:
- Fan Favorite Game: Fortnite
- Fan Favorite Multiplayer Game: Fortnite
- Fan Favorite Esports Game: Fortnite
- Fan Favorite Battle Royale Game: Fortnite
- Fan Favorite Gaming Moment: Drake plays [Fortnite] with Ninja
- Fan Favorite Esports Player (Fortnite): Ninja
- Fan Favorite Overall Esports Player: Ninja
- Fan Favorite Esports League Format: Fortnite - Community Skirmishes
Red Dead Redemption 2 for example has won a single silly nomination titled "Fan Favorite Fall Release", whereas God of War was only noted for the Christopher Judge's performance as Kratos.
